@props(['variant' => 'primary']) @php $variants = [ 'primary' => 'bg-blue-50 text-booklio-primary', 'success' => 'bg-emerald-50 text-emerald-600', 'warning' => 'bg-amber-50 text-amber-600', 'danger' => 'bg-red-50 text-red-600', 'purple' => 'bg-violet-50 text-violet-600', 'muted' => 'bg-slate-100 text-slate-600', ]; @endphp merge(['class' => 'inline-flex max-w-full items-center overflow-hidden text-ellipsis whitespace-nowrap rounded-full px-2.5 py-1 text-xs font-bold ' . ($variants[$variant] ?? $variants['primary'])]) }}> {{ $slot }}